Mortgage Loan Application Detail Totals for Residential Loan Centers in 2004

Loan Purpose

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
Refinancing 2,291 $328,547,000 $127,666 $1,320,000 $55,222 $1,200,000
Home Purchase 683 $116,750,000 $152,125 $950,000 $75,500 $780,000
Home Improvement 2 $216,000 $108,000 $152,000 $61,500 $69,000

Applicant Race

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
White 1,409 $232,834,000 $147,000 $1,320,000 $69,777 $1,200,000
Not Provided 693 $103,317,000 $118,777 $718,000 $56,777 $816,000
Black or African American 519 $58,282,000 $113,750 $445,000 $45,500 $217,000
Hispanic 236 $33,707,000 $110,250 $375,000 $45,875 $162,000
Asian 87 $12,808,000 $138,571 $472,000 $87,857 $194,000
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islander 18 $2,651,000 $115,666 $315,000 $57,000 $164,000
American Indian or Alaskan Native 14 $1,914,000 $118,750 $348,000 $46,000 $122,000
Not applicable 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0

Loan Type

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
Conventional (any loan other than FHA, VA, FSA, or RHS loans) 2,740 $415,726,000 $128,666 $1,320,000 $64,666 $1,200,000
FHA-insured (Federal Housing Administration) 236 $29,787,000 $110,428 $375,000 $17,142 $128,000
FSA/RHS (Farm Service Agency or Rural Housing Service) 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
VA-guaranteed (Veterans Administration) 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0

Outcome

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
Loan Originated 2,207 $348,056,000 $136,222 $1,320,000 $60,444 $1,200,000
Application Denied By Financial Institution 402 $47,698,000 $108,888 $583,000 $68,777 $399,000
Application Withdrawn By Applicant 367 $49,759,000 $129,333 $800,000 $52,888 $237,000
File Closed For Incompleteness 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
Application Approved But Not Accepted 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
Loan Purchased By The Institution 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
Preapproval Approved but not Accepted 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
Preapproval Denied by Financial Institution 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0

Denial Reason

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
Collateral 151 $17,994,000 $111,333 $385,000 $82,777 $399,000
Other 71 $6,941,000 $84,571 $250,000 $37,714 $266,000
Credit History 64 $7,329,000 $136,800 $583,000 $40,000 $162,000
Debt-To-Income Ratio 45 $5,474,000 $81,000 $350,000 $33,833 $153,000
Unverifiable Information 16 $1,892,000 $118,250 $256,000 $39,250 $90,000
Insufficient Cash (Downpayment, Closing Cost) 7 $1,312,000 $157,000 $490,000 $66,000 $140,000
Employment History 3 $236,000 $62,000 $117,000 $39,000 $66,000
Credit Application Incomplete 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
Mortgage Insurance Denied 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
